Pp
Index
A Process Performance Index.
The ratio of the tolerance (specification, or permitted amount of variation)
to the variation in a sample.
- A value of 1 indicates
the sample variation exactly equals the tolerance.
- Values of less
than 1 indicate the allowable variation (the tolerance) is less than
the sample variation.
- Values of more
than 1 indicate that the sample variation is less than the tolerance.
- Use of Performance
Indices is generally discouraged in favor of Capability Indices wherever
possible.
